Build Provenance — Pinefold Transcode Farm. Every encoder image on the farm is built from a pinned base and signed by the Lanternwood release pipeline before deployment to worker pools in the Dray cluster. Reviewers can verify that source, compiler flags, and codec libraries match the attestation manifest stored alongside each artifact. No unsigned images are admitted. The provenance record for the current fleet carries the token below.

pipeline stamp: htk9_ce63042d9

Postmortem timeline — Threadvane tracing outage.

14:02 — Spanroute collector began dropping spans from the Orbiter checkout service.
14:11 — On-call noticed orphaned traces; propagation header missing after a Helmsley sidecar upgrade.
14:25 — Rolled back sidecar on two nodes; spans resumed.
14:40 — Full rollback complete, trace continuity restored.
15:05 — Confirmed no customer impact; dashboards normal.

Root cause: sidecar stripped custom headers by default. The offending release is identified by the token below.

pipeline stamp: htk31_f769b577b3028a4e9958e5bb8d1259a

**Q: Why did the Gridloom crossword generator stop emitting puzzles overnight?**

Usually the wordbank vault auto-locked after its weekly key rotation. Check the generator logs for "bank sealed" entries. Restarting the service does not help; it just retries against a locked bank. Relevant for the eng sync: this has happened three weeks running, ticket pending. To unlock manually, run `gridloom bank unlock` and enter the recovery passphrase, which is:

unlock words, hahip-baduf: holwyn-istath-julvan

**Ticket: Config drift on FlagPilot rollout workers**

Heads up, future maintainers: the FlagPilot rollout workers in the east cluster have drifted from what's in the repo again. Someone hand-edited the percentage-step settings during the Lanternfish launch and never backported the change, so fresh deploys keep flip-flopping behavior. Please don't hot-edit these boxes — change the repo, redeploy, done. To make the drift obvious, I'm pinning what the workers are *actually* running right now. Current live configuration values follow.

service settings:
PRAIX_LOG_LEVEL=error
PRAIX_METRICS_HOST=metrics.praix.qorvelcorp.corp
PRAIX_POOL_SIZE=16